1. Use Row 1 to write a ratio for the amount of apple juice to orange juice used in 1 smoothie. 2. Use row 3 to write an equivalent ratio for the amount of apple juice to orange juice used in 3 smoothies. To create this ratio, what did Sarah do to each number in row 1?3. How many ounces of apple juice should Sarah use to make 2 smoothies? Explain how you found your answer. 4. To make 5 smoothies that have the same ratio of apple juice to orange juice as 1 smoothie does, how much apple juice and orange juice should Sarah use? Explain.

Step-by-step explanation:

1) To make 1 smothie, 4 orange juice and 8 apple juice was used

Ratio for amount of apple juice to orange juice = 8 : 4

2) for 3 smoothies, 12 orange juice and 24 apple juice was used

Ratio for the amount of appl juice to orange juice = 24 : 12

3) To make 2 smoothies, 8 orange juice was used

We need to find amount of apple juice used:

From 1 to 2 smoothies for orange juice, amount increased from 4 to 8

multiplying factor = 8/4 = 2

This shows that to increase the amount of juice we multiply the amount for 1 smoothies by 2

8 = 4 ×2

For apple juice = 8 × 2 = 16

Hence, Sarah should use 16 ounces of apple juice

4) ratio of juice for 1 smoothie, apple to orange = 8 : 4

For 5 smoothies:

Amount of apple juice = 8 × 5 = 40

Amount of orange juice = 4 × 5 = 20
